Cover: saec. XVII, in parchment glued on cardboard</p> <p> Watermark: jug, on top a fleur-de-lis (fol. 33); two pillars, rounded, between them letters BO (fol. 75-76); bugle horn in a shield (throughout Hope's "Minor practicks", despite the changes of hands, and throughout the Styles, well visible in last folio).</p> <p> Fol. 1-30 are torn out. Only two small scraps of them are preserved, before fol. 31. Five threads of the lost quires of paper can be seen, and this matches the pattern of the subsequent quires which are composed of three bifolia each, so that the five threads are leftovers of five lost quires of three bifolia = 30 folios
